Diving into the world of music distribution as a musician can feel like navigating uncharted territory, especially when it comes to submitting cover songs. Unlike your self-written works, cover songs come with a unique set of rules. Before you publish your rendition of that beloved track, research yourself with the ownership landscape to ensure you're acting within the parameters set by music rights holders.
- First, identify the permissions associated with the track. This often involves researching the composer and publisher behind the sound.
- Subsequently, consider approval options. You may need to secure a license from the rights holder to legally release your cover version.
- Finally, opt for a distribution platform that aligns with your requirements. There are numerous platforms available, each with its own set of options and listener base.
Keep in mind that transparency and adherence for copyright laws are fundamental to a successful cover song distribution journey.

Understanding Cover Song Licensing: A Guide to Rights and Revenue
Embarking on a musical journey that involves reinterpreting existing tracks can be exhilarating, but it's crucial to navigate the intricacies of musical rights first. As a artist, when you choose to reimagine someone else's composition, you're stepping into a world governed by legal frameworks that protect the original songwriter's work.
- Securing the necessary licenses ensures that you respect these legal boundaries.
- Understanding remuneration and how they are calculated is paramount.
- Recording companies often play a role in the licensing process, helping to streamline the transfer of rights for your cover song.
By immerse yourself in the fundamentals of cover song licensing, you can successfully traverse these waters. This knowledge empowers you to create and share your music with confidence, knowing that you're operating within the bounds of the law.
